Each year, over 300,000 women in the United States alone are diagnosed with some form of breast cancer, yet that doesn't tell the whole story. Today, more than 4 million women worldwide are living with this diseaseboth during and after treatments. Knowing that 1 in 8 women will develop this disease in their lifetime, bestselling health author Dr. Pamela Wartian Smith has written this book to answer the many crucial questions women may have about this cancer. The book is divided into two sections. Part 1 looks at the basicsthe nature of this illness, how it is diagnosed, and the various forms it may take. It then looks at the conventional treatments now available, including surgery, radiation, and hormonal and chemotherapy protocols. Part 2 examines the risk factors that may bring on this type of cancerthe ones that cannot be changed (such as age, gender, and genetics), and those that can be changed (including cigarette addiction, poor diet, obesity, and more). This section explains why these factors are harmful, and what you can do to minimize or eliminate these risks entirely. It also focuses on the immune system. The human body has a natural defense against diseases, including cancers. By knowing how to maximize this first line of protection, you stand your very best shot at being able to help prevent breast canceror its potential reoccurrence. In How to Prevent Breast CancerBefore & After, Dr. Smith provides a comprehensive and up-to-date look at what breast cancer is, how it is treated, and what can be done to protect women against getting it the first timeand what can be done to avoid its unwanted return.
Pamela Wartian Smith, MD, MPH, MS, is a diplomate of the American Academy of Anti-Aging Physicians and director of the Master's Program in Medical Sciences, with a concentration in Metabolic and Nutritional Medicine, at the University of South Florida School of Medicine. An authority on the subjects of wellness and anti-aging, Dr. Smith is also director of the Fellowship in Anti-Aging, Regenerative, and Functional Medicine. Currently, she is the owner and director of the Center for Healthy Living, with locations in Michigan and Florida.
